Transaction cc3a8f3e5a51a29dad81f73baa60c75d45c8ef991b417164ec404964fca58a87
1 Input
1 Output
-
cc3a8f3e5a51a29dad81f73baa60c75d45c8ef991b417164ec404964fca58a87:0
- value
- 74109
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6285e4454a21d208ae24b1878637cbdf65a7b0f
- address
- bc1q5c59u3z55gwjpzhzfvv8scmuhhm957c05g768f